Swift 语言 代码规范的持续更新和维护

Swift阿木 发布于 13 天前 5 次阅读


阿木博主一句话概括:Swift 语言代码规范的持续更新与维护:构建高质量代码的基石

阿木博主为你简单介绍:
随着 Swift 语言的不断发展,其代码规范也在不断更新和完善。本文将围绕 Swift 语言代码规范的持续更新与维护这一主题,探讨代码规范的重要性、更新原则、维护策略以及如何在实际项目中应用这些规范,旨在帮助开发者构建高质量、可维护的 Swift 代码。

一、
Swift 语言自 2014 年发布以来,以其简洁、安全、高效的特点受到了广大开发者的喜爱。随着 Swift 语言的不断更新,其代码规范也在不断演变。为了确保代码质量,维护良好的开发环境,持续更新和维护 Swift 代码规范显得尤为重要。

二、代码规范的重要性
1. 提高代码可读性:统一的代码规范有助于提高代码的可读性,使其他开发者更容易理解和维护代码。
2. 降低维护成本:遵循代码规范可以减少因代码风格不一致而导致的维护成本。
3. 提高团队协作效率:统一的代码规范有助于团队成员之间的协作,提高开发效率。
4. 遵循最佳实践:代码规范通常基于最佳实践,有助于开发者遵循最佳编程习惯。

三、Swift 代码规范的更新原则
1. 稳定性:更新后的规范应保持一定的稳定性,避免频繁变动。
2. 可行性:更新后的规范应易于实施,避免过于复杂或难以遵守。
3. 适应性:更新后的规范应适应 Swift 语言的最新特性。
4. 社区反馈:更新过程中应充分考虑社区反馈,确保规范的合理性和实用性。

四、Swift 代码规范的维护策略
1. 定期审查:定期对代码规范进行审查,确保其与 Swift 语言的最新特性保持一致。
2. 持续更新:根据 Swift 语言的更新,及时调整代码规范。
3. 社区参与:鼓励开发者参与代码规范的讨论和更新,提高规范的实用性和可接受度。
4. 工具支持:开发辅助工具,如代码格式化工具、静态代码分析工具等,帮助开发者遵循规范。

五、实际应用
1. 代码格式化:使用 Xcode 或其他代码编辑器自带的代码格式化功能,确保代码风格一致。
2. 静态代码分析:使用 SwiftLint 等静态代码分析工具,检查代码是否符合规范。
3. 代码审查:在代码提交前进行审查,确保代码质量。
4. 持续集成:将代码规范集成到持续集成系统中,自动检查代码质量。

六、总结
Swift 代码规范的持续更新与维护是构建高质量代码的基石。通过遵循更新原则、实施维护策略以及在实际项目中应用规范,开发者可以确保代码质量,提高团队协作效率,为 Swift 生态系统的繁荣发展贡献力量。

参考文献:
[1] Swift 编程语言官方文档
[2] SwiftLint 官方文档
[3] Xcode 官方文档
[4] Swift 社区论坛

注:本文约 3000 字,实际字数可能因排版和引用内容而有所差异。